Statute of Limitations
Different kinds of legal claims can have different statutes depending on the nature and the circumstances of an incident. A statute of limitations is the maximum time frame an individual can file a lawsuit in order to obtain compensation for their injuries. If a person injured in an accident lawyers near me files their lawsuit after the statute has expired, it is highly unlikely that they will succeed.
The "clock" of the statute of limitations usually starts to tick when a damage or injury occurs. However, New York law also has a discovery rule which can delay the clock and allow victims to make a claim within a reasonable amount of time after they've discovered their injuries. This exception is also important for cases of medical malpractice which could mean that victims did not discover their injuries until after the incident that caused the injuries.
The statute of limitations could also be tolled or paused in certain circumstances, if it is unfair to let the filing of a lawsuit within the time frame. For example, in cases involving the COVID-19 pandemic the statute of limitations is suspended until it is safe to start filing lawsuits.
If someone seeks compensation for losses they have suffered due to another's negligent actions, they should consult an experienced Manhattan personal injury lawyer to ensure that they don't miss the statute of limitations deadline. Failure to comply could result in the loss of the right to seek compensation for medical expenses as well as property damage, the pain and suffering. Preparation
The process of hiring an attorney can seem like a lot of work to add to your already hectic life after being injured in a wreck. However, it is important to know what you can expect from the initial consultation and prepare for the questions that your lawyer will ask. The right information will allow you to focus on your health and the other aspects of your life while your lawyer works to get the maximum compensation for you.
Bringing all of the relevant documentation and evidence to your first meeting with an attorney who handles accidents and injuries will only strengthen your case. Included are medical records, bills, photographs of the scene of the accident and the vehicles involved, eyewitness reports, and correspondence with anyone you has contacted about the incident. Keep receipts for expenses such as medical costs, transportation costs, out-of-pocket expenses as well as home repair. The information you provide will help your attorney calculate the exact and future economic damages you're entitled to under your demand.
Your lawyer will require details of how your accident happened and the injuries you sustained. You can prepare for this ahead of time by writing down all of the details while they're fresh in your mind. You'll be required to record any psychological or physical impacts that the injury could have had on your life. It can be helpful to create a list.
In the end, it's a good idea to visit medical professionals to diagnose and treat your injuries as soon as is possible after the accident. Not only will you receive the treatment you require, but your attorney will have a track record to present in negotiations with the insurer.
Negotiation
When a person suffers severe injuries from an Accident And Injury Attorneys [Https://Postheaven.Net/], they might be overwhelmed and confused about the legal implications. Often, they are also concerned about their immediate and future financial requirements. Loss of wages, medical expenses and property damage might be on their list. Fortunately, personal injury lawyers can help injured accident victims to receive fair compensation from liable insurance companies through a variety of tactics during the negotiation process.
One of the most important things that an attorney can do during negotiations, is to accurately and carefully examine the extent of their client's losses. This means obtaining documents from experts such as medical professionals and economists, to prove the extent of the client's losses. Lawyers should include in their accounting the costs associated with accidents, which include future expenses as well as other factors like diminished earning capacity, mental distress.
After an attorney has determined the worth of the claim, they will then send an order letter to the insurance company. The demand letter will usually include the amount of settlement that the person who has been injured is seeking, including past and future medical costs along with lost wages, and other losses. Lawyers may also include a statement that states that they're prepared to file a lawsuit in case they're not happy with the initial settlement offered by the insurance company.
In the majority of states, if a person is at fault in an accident, the amount of compensation for their damages will be reduced by the proportion of the total blame assigned to them. A skilled lawyer for accidents and injuries will review the insurance policy of the liable party to ensure that the amount demanded is in the maximum amount available under the policy.
Trial
After a thorough analysis of the incident and the injuries you sustained, your attorney will determine how much compensation you will need to cover your losses. They will then present this demand to insurance companies. This could lead to an ongoing negotiation until the settlement is reached.
If you and your insurance company are unable reach an agreement, the case will be tried before a jury or judge. The courtroom is a tense environment with strict procedures that your injury lawyer has spent years studying and practicing to master.
During the trial both parties will be able to question witnesses about their knowledge of what transpired. Your lawyer will consult with any experts who can help establish your case and demonstrate to the jury the extent of your injuries. They will also consult your medical records to seek an opinion from your doctor regarding the long-term impact of your injuries and what your future may look like if they're permanent.
Your defense attorney can introduce evidence in court including documents, photos, and physical objects. They'll also summon experts to challenge your claims by arguing that the incident isn't the manner you describe or that your injuries aren't as severe as you claim.
Both sides will be able to present closing arguments after all the evidence has been presented. They will draw attention to important pieces of evidence and attempt to convince the jury to make a decision in their favor. Depending on the severity of your case, it could take anywhere from a few hours to several days for the jury to make an informed decision.
